In 1994, Walmart — the world’s largest retailer — inaugurated a Supplier Diversity Programme that aims to continually expand its supplier base with a view to adding diversity to its supply chain. To implement the Programme, Walmart has established a Supplier Diversity Internal Steering Committee with senior leaders from all business units — Operating Divisions, Marketing, Logistics, International, Information Systems, Legal and Real Estate. The Supplier Diversity Internal Steering Committee has been charged with creating a plan of action for doing business with more minority and women-owned suppliers that enhances both Walmart’s and the suppliers’ business growth. The Programme has grown from an initial US$2 million investment in 1994 to a US$158 billion programme as of the end of 2019, impacting 3,000 diverse suppliers both through direct and indirect procurement.
